Modern IT monitoring systems for cryogenic storage of biomaterial in an umbilical blood bank
Annotation
This paper overviews the activities of an umbilical blood bank to optimize the quality of the preserved umbilical cord blood samples, and provides a description of the innovative IT system developed in Russia for monitoring cryostorage conditions of such cord blood samples and maintaining a database of the preserved materials.
